Solution
For the vast majority of games, get the 1060. You will get higher FPS than just going with a 6600k.

However, you will still get some bottlenecking in CPU demanding areas, so eventually a 6600k/7600k is a good upgrade still.

Also keep in mind that if the computer is used for more than just gaming, the CPU will be of much more benefit than the GPU.

Other things to consider gaming wise is the amount of RAM and type of storage. Switching from a platter to a SSD will definitely help with load times, and 8gb or more of RAM will help prevent memory paging.
